..:: PCSX2 Forums ::..

Full Version: Unofficial linux build
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Pages: 1 2 3 4 5 6 7 8 9 10
Hello Linux users,

Here a recent build with latest improvement from the 1.0.0 branch! You can also find a recent trunk build. I also include the source tarball for linux distribution. Enjoy nice GSdx-ogl improvement

Note: plugins of 1.0.0 are not compatible with PCSX2 0.9.8 (linux).
Note2: This time I drop SDL1.3 dependency (cause too much trouble), unfortunately you loose force feedback support.
Note3: I used my Debian/Sid distribution so you might miss some recent library.

Enjoys

Edit: new version of GSdx based on revision 5752.
(06-27-2011, 07:57 PM)gregory Wrote: [ -> ]Hello Linux users,

Unfortunately there are several issue with the current 0.9.8 release. To ease my life and save you the hassle of build, I attach a recent snapshot to this thread.

Note: plugins of 0.9.9 are not compatible with PCSX2 0.9.8 (linux).
Note2: I build with SDL1.3 so you will able to use/test GSdx and forcefeedback on linux.

Changelog against 0.9.8:
* onepad: fix analog joystick detection
* zzogl: fix extension detection issue with old card (geforce 7xxx)
* support of GSopen2. PCSX2 shortcut must work now !

Edit: plugins update 4789
* spu2x 2.0 : improve game compatibility
* zzogl : temporary workaround to avoid crash with geforce7xxx...

Enjoys

Hello,
It's a build for 32 or 64 bits platform ?
(07-12-2011, 11:15 PM)SiOuZ Wrote: [ -> ]Hello,
It's a build for 32 or 64 bits platform ?

Both Wink The binary are 32 bits so it can be run on both. However on 64 bits platform you need to install the 32 bits libraries.
(07-13-2011, 08:43 AM)gregory Wrote: [ -> ]Both Wink The binary are 32 bits so it can be run on both. However on 64 bits platform you need to install the 32 bits libraries.

Because I have this issue :

Quote:siou@MacBook ~/pcsx2_r4777 $ ./launch_pcsx2_linux.sh
Inconsistency detected by ld.so: dl-deps.c: 622: _dl_map_object_deps: Assertion `nlist > 1' failed!

I have the same error on my book and my desktop, both have Gentoo :

[/code]
siou@MacBook ~/pcsx2_r4777 $ uname -a
Linux MacBook 2.6.37-gentoo #6 SMP PREEMPT Thu Feb 17 23:33:33 CET 2011 x86_64 Intel® Core™2 Duo CPU T9600 @ 2.80GHz GenuineIntel GNU/Linux
[code]
Do not know Gentoo details. But here some hint
1/ multilib overlay
2/ kernel ia32 compatibility

Otherwise, create a chroot. Read this page: http://code.google.com/p/pcsx2/wiki/Chro...tatusLinux It contain a link to a gentoo tutorial for PCSX2
(07-13-2011, 06:47 PM)gregory Wrote: [ -> ]Do not know Gentoo details. But here some hint
1/ multilib overlay
2/ kernel ia32 compatibility

Otherwise, create a chroot. Read this page: http://code.google.com/p/pcsx2/wiki/Chro...tatusLinux It contain a link to a gentoo tutorial for PCSX2

1) ok for this overlay, but what package ?!
2) My kernel has ia32 compatibility
3) Install a chroot environnement just for start pcsx2, it's just a little big joke.

4) It's sad, all ebuild for gentoo (on http://gpo.zugaina.org/games-emulation/pcsx2) are down, and the last update for the overlay pcsx2 was 2009.



Well it seems you got some issue with the library loader, so maybe you miss libc and core program I do not know. Then install dependency of pcsx2, you can find them in google code wiki.

Maybe begin easy and try to run a 32bits glxgears. If this small program work then you can try PCSX2.

By the way on 3), in my opinion a not ideal solution is better than nothing.

(07-13-2011, 09:45 AM)SiOuZ Wrote: [ -> ]siou@MacBook ~/pcsx2_r4777 $ uname -a
Linux MacBook 2.6.37-gentoo #6 SMP PREEMPT Thu Feb 17 23:33:33 CET 2011 x86_64 Intel® Core™2 Duo CPU T9600 @ 2.80GHz GenuineIntel GNU/Linux

Finally, this error came fom my version of glibc (with the new revision of glibc this error is gone.

But I have a new error :X

Quote:siou@siou-desktop ~/Gentoo/Pcsx2/pcsx2_r4777 $ ./launch_pcsx2_linux.sh
./pcsx2: error while loading shared libraries: libwx_baseu-2.8.so.0: cannot open shared object file: No such file or directory

however, i have wxGTK installed :

Quote:[I] x11-libs/wxGTK
Available versions:
(2.6) 2.6.4.0-r6
(2.8) 2.8.10.1-r5 2.8.11.0 (~)2.8.12.0
(2.9) [M](~)2.9.1.1
{X debug doc gnome gstreamer odbc opengl pch sdl tiff unicode}
Installed versions: 2.8.12.0(2.8)(14:32:05 14/07/2011)(X gnome opengl sdl tiff -debug -doc -gstreamer -odbc -pch)
Homepage: http://wxwidgets.org/
Description: GTK+ version of wxWidgets, a cross-platform C++ GUI toolkit.

this package content the lib libwx_baseu (http://www.portagefilelist.de/index.php/...ile#result) installed in /usb/lib/ Wacko
Do a ldd pcsx2 | grep -i libwx
Quote:siou@new-host ~/Gentoo/Pcsx2/pcsx2_r4777 $ ldd pcsx2 | grep -i libwx
libwx_baseu-2.8.so.0 => not found
libwx_gtk2u_core-2.8.so.0 => not found
libwx_gtk2u_adv-2.8.so.0 => not found

Where does it look?
Because i have them in /usr/lib/ Wacko
Pages: 1 2 3 4 5 6 7 8 9 10